In this conversation, filmmaker and political commentator Sara Alessandrini returns to the show to discuss her experiences living in Los Angeles, the recent LA mayoral race featuring incumbent Karen Bass, DSA candidate Nithya Raman, and Spencer Pratt, and the city's ongoing struggles with homelessness, crime, business closures, and ineffective governance.
